Redefining exclusivity online
Digital marketing is transforming the luxury wine market by introducing a sophisticated layer of digital exclusivity that mirrors, and even elevates, the traditional aura of scarcity and privilege. Through advanced customer segmentation, brands can target premium wine consumers with tailored experiences, ensuring that exclusivity is not lost in the online transition. Gated content—such as members-only web pages, exclusive newsletters, or invitation-only access to rare vintages—cultivates a sense of belonging among select audiences. Limited-edition digital campaigns, often leveraging countdown timers or exclusive pre-sale alerts, strategically heighten anticipation, reinforcing the scarcity that underpins the allure of fine wines.
Personalized wine marketing delivers an online wine experience that feels bespoke, maintaining the intimate connection expected of luxury brands. Private virtual tastings, hosted for small groups or even individuals, offer interactive and immersive encounters, giving customers the opportunity to directly engage with winemakers or sommeliers. This approach not only preserves the sense of privilege but also enhances perceived value by offering access and insights unavailable to the general public. In this way, digital exclusivity in the luxury wine market shapes consumer perception, ensuring that rarity and personalization remain central, even as the industry embraces new digital frontiers.
Expanding global reach
Digital wine marketing empowers luxury wine producers to enter the global wine market while preserving their exclusive brand reputation. Through sophisticated multilingual e-commerce platforms, luxury wine consumers from different countries can seamlessly access and purchase rare vintages. By implementing geo-targeting, producers tailor online wine sales campaigns to specific regions, cultures, and languages, ensuring relevance and resonance with each international wine audience. Targeted international campaigns, including collaborations with local influencers and curated digital events, further enable prestigious wineries to establish personal connections with affluent clientele across continents. Storytelling via online channels, such as immersive website content and virtual vineyard tours, reinforces the unique heritage and craftsmanship behind each bottle. These strategies not only extend luxury brands’ visibility far beyond traditional markets but also break down geographical barriers, making elite labels accessible to discerning buyers worldwide without diluting their aura of exclusivity.
Enhancing customer engagement
Digital marketing is transforming luxury wine marketing by elevating customer engagement through immersive engagement strategies. Brands now frequently deploy interactive wine content, such as guided virtual vineyard tours that allow the premium wine audience to explore scenic estates and production processes without leaving their homes. Sommelier-led webinars and masterclasses present another powerful tool, offering direct access to wine experts who share tasting notes, cellar techniques, and food pairing guidance in real time. These virtual wine events not only educate but also foster a deep sense of connection between the brand and its clientele, encouraging repeat participation and emotional brand loyalty.
The power of immersive engagement extends to social media platforms, where luxury wine brands curate rich, visually stunning experiences. Live tastings, behind-the-scenes stories, and interactive polls or Q&A sessions encourage active involvement from the premium wine audience. Such digital touchpoints allow brands to remain top-of-mind while delivering personalized experiences that stand out in a competitive market. The ability to immediately respond to questions or comments in these settings further strengthens customer relationships and increases brand trust.
Exclusive digital invitations to limited-release events or private tastings have become highly sought-after among luxury consumers. These initiatives utilize data-driven insights to segment audiences and deliver tailored experiences, cementing the brand's reputation for sophistication and exclusivity. Additionally, technologies like augmented reality labels or 360-degree vineyard walkthroughs are used to craft interactive wine content that captivates tech-savvy connoisseurs, encouraging them to share their experiences online and amplify brand reach.

Leveraging data-driven insights
The luxury wine sector is increasingly adopting wine market analytics and luxury wine data to fine-tune digital marketing strategies and anticipate evolving consumer preferences. By tracking purchase behaviors through advanced CRM tools, brands gain a detailed understanding of customer journeys and segment high-value clients with precision. Digital marketing insights derived from predictive analytics enable marketers to forecast luxury wine trends, adjust messaging, and tailor offers to fit the nuanced tastes and expectations of affluent consumers. Utilizing wine customer analytics, campaigns can be optimized in real time, allocating resources where they generate the highest return and ensuring that marketing efforts deeply resonate with targeted audiences. This data-driven approach not only increases the efficiency of digital campaigns but also positions brands to proactively respond to shifts in consumer demand, driving sustained success in the competitive luxury wine market.
Building online wine communities
Digital platforms now serve as vibrant hubs for bringing together luxury wine enthusiasts, offering experiences that transcend traditional marketing. A luxury wine community manager leverages community management techniques to create exclusive wine platforms where members connect, share insights, and access curated content. These include initiatives like digital wine clubs, which offer rare tastings, private events, and behind-the-scenes insights, as well as member-only forums designed to cultivate discussion among serious collectors and connoisseurs. In this context, influencer collaborations introduce these communities to broader audiences, showcasing the unique value of belonging to a premium network.
Online wine community development focuses on nurturing an atmosphere where members feel a true sense of belonging. Through strategic community management, luxury brands can provide tailored experiences such as live virtual tastings, Q&A sessions with winemakers, and early access to limited releases. This targeted engagement helps deepen connections between members and brands, encouraging recurring participation and advocacy. The result is a digital wine club model that not only connects individuals with similar interests but also elevates the exclusivity often associated with the luxury wine sector.
An exclusive wine platform supported by robust community management is instrumental in reinforcing wine brand loyalty. By facilitating direct communication between brands and their audience, and by rewarding member engagement with unique benefits, brands ensure that luxury wine enthusiasts remain invested in both the product and the experience. Such online communities are rapidly reshaping the landscape of the luxury wine market, making it possible for brands to foster lasting relationships and maintain a competitive edge in an increasingly digital world.
